When it’s time to upgrade your devices, it’s important to dispose of old electronics safely and responsibly. Here’s how:
Erase Your Data: Before getting rid of your device, make sure to erase all personal data to protect your privacy. Use factory reset settings to wipe all information.
Recycle Responsibly: Many electronics contain materials that can be recycled. Find a certified e-waste recycling center to ensure proper disposal.
Donate or Repurpose: If your old electronics still work, consider donating them to charity or repurposing them for other uses, like turning an old smartphone into a home security camera.
Remove Batteries: For devices that contain batteries, ensure they are removed and disposed of separately at a proper facility to prevent environmental harm.
By following these tips, you can dispose of your electronics in a way that’s both secure and environmentally friendly.
